Role Overview

Working as a Science Technician, you will play an important role in preparing practical lessons, maintaining laboratory equipment and supporting teachers in delivering engaging science education.

Responsibilities

  • Prepare laboratory equipment for practical lessons.

  • Maintain science resources and equipment.

  • Carry out stock checks and organise deliveries.

  • Ensure laboratories remain safe and compliant.

  • Support practical demonstrations when required.

  • Dispose of materials safely and responsibly.

  • Keep accurate equipment records.
